France eSIM brief
France sits fully inside the EU 'Roam Like At Home' zone, so most travel eSIMs sold for France are Europe-regional plans that keep working across the EU as you cross borders. Coverage is excellent — including the Paris Métro and TGV routes — with widespread 5G in the cities. Great for city-breakers and anyone touring multiple European countries on a single eSIM.

Three things to know
- Most France eSIMs are EU-regional plans that work across the EU under 'Roam Like At Home' — handy if you'll cross borders — but Monaco and Andorra sit outside the EU zone, so check those separately.
- Coverage is strong nationwide (Orange-based plans reach rural and mountain areas best), the Paris Métro has full in-tunnel 4G, and 5G is widespread in major cities.
- A travel eSIM is a roaming line: enable Data Roaming on the eSIM after installing it, or it won't pass data.
- Light users (maps, messaging, light browsing) rarely need more than about 1 GB a day — roughly 5 GB covers a typical week.
